How much do document delivery dri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for document delivery driver in the United States is $18.45,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.11 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Document Delivery Drivers?

Document Delivery Drivers are professionals responsible for transporting important documents, packages, or materials between businesses, organizations, or clients. Their primary role is to ensure timely and secure delivery, often adhering to schedules and handling sensitive or confidential items. They may use cars, vans, or motorcycles and are expected to maintain accurate delivery records. This job typically requires strong organizational skills, reliability, and a good driving record.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Document Delivery Driver,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Document Delivery Driver, you need a valid driver’s license, a clean driving record, familiarity with local routes, and basic literacy for handling documentation.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, route optimization apps, and sometimes handheld scanners is typically required. Reliability, time management, and strong customer service skills help drivers efficiently complete deliveries and interact professionally with clients. These skills ensure timely, accurate, and secure document delivery, which is critical for maintaining business operations and client trust.

How to become a legal document courier?

To become a legal document courier, you typically need a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, and knowledge of local traffic laws. Some employers may require a background check and good organizational skills, as the job involves handling sensitive legal documents and adhering to strict deadlines.

What is the difference between Document Delivery Driver vs Courier?

AspectDocument Delivery DriverCourier
CredentialsValid driver’s license, sometimes a background checkValid driver’s license, sometimes specialized certifications
Work EnvironmentUrban and suburban areas, delivering documents and small packagesVaried environments, delivering parcels, documents, or goods
Employer & IndustryLegal, medical, or business sectors; often local companiesLogistics, e-commerce, retail sectors; courier companies or independent

Document Delivery Drivers primarily focus on delivering important documents within specific areas, often for legal or medical purposes. Couriers have a broader scope, delivering various parcels and goods across wider regions. Both roles require a valid driver’s license and operate in similar environments, but couriers typically handle larger or more diverse deliveries.

What are some common challenges faced by Document Delivery Drivers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Document Delivery Drivers often face challenges such as navigating traffic congestion, adhering to tight delivery schedules, and ensuring the secure handling of sensitive documents. To manage these effectively, drivers typically plan optimal routes using GPS and traffic apps, maintain clear communication with dispatchers and clients, and follow strict protocols for document security and confidentiality. Developing strong organizational skills and staying adaptable to changing conditions are also crucial for success in this role.
